Electrical Technician 3/4 (Nuclear & Hazardous Materials) Los Alamos National Laboratory Los Alamos, NM
Los Alamos National Laboratory (LANL) is a multidisciplinary research institution engaged in science and engineering on behalf of national security. The Process Maintenance & Decontamination Services (PMDS) Team is seeking an Electrical Technician (Nuclear & Hazardous Materials Tech 3/4) to join our facility. In this role, you will support mission‑critical manufacturing operations in a high‑consequence environment, providing hands‑on electrical technical support across specialized equipment and systems used in national security applications.
This position will be filled at either level 3 or level 4, depending on the selected candidate’s experience and qualifications. This is an onsite role in Los Alamos, NM, with potential 24/7 coverage, shift/weekend schedules, and a salary range as follows:
- Electrical Technician 3: $66,100 – $103,600
- Electrical Technician 4: $72,800 – $115,400
